It seems the stars are lining up just right for the city of Chicago these days. First, there is the meteoric rise of Barack Obama. The story is made of the stuff of legends.
And the White Sox are winning. And the Cubs are winning (although we all know that can't possibly last). And the 2016 Summer Olympic bid is well on its way. And then there is this.
From the entertainment page comes news that "August: Osage County," the hit drama for Chicago's Steppenwolf Theatre Company and a 2008 Pulitzer Prize winner, is the odds-on favorite to win the Tony Award for best play.It just goes on. Politics, sports, entertainment and food. Yep, it is all lining up for Chicago. Let us hope it lasts. Reading on Walden Bookstore.
On the food page is the news that Grant Achatz of Chicago's Alinea restaurant has been named the country's top chef by the James Beard Foundation.
